I. Executive Summary and Procedural Information

  • Parties & Counsel:
  • Case Identification: 7:26-cv-00099, W.D. Tex., 03/23/2026
  • Venue Allegations: Plaintiff alleges venue is proper because Defendants have committed acts of infringement in the district, C & C North America has a regular and established place of business in the district, and Cosentino Industrial is a foreign corporation that may be sued in any judicial district.
  • Core Dispute: Plaintiff alleges that Defendant’s quartz surface products, sold under brands including Silestone, infringe three patents related to the composition of and methods for manufacturing engineered stone slabs with veined appearances.
  • Technical Context: The case concerns the market for engineered quartz slabs, a popular alternative to natural quarried stone for applications like countertops, which relies on technology to create aesthetically complex and reproducible surface patterns.
  • Key Procedural History: The complaint notes that the parties previously litigated infringement of the ’762 and ’440 patents, which resulted in a settlement covering products released at that time. Plaintiff alleges that this new suit concerns new products released by Defendant since the settlement. Plaintiff also alleges it provided Defendant with notice of the ’718 patent via letter.

II. Technology and Patent(s)-in-Suit Analysis

U.S. Patent No. 10,195,762 - Processed Slabs, and Systems and Methods Related Thereto (Issued Feb. 5, 2019)

The Invention Explained

  • Problem Addressed: The patent addresses the difficulty of manufacturing engineered stone slabs that emulate the complex, veined appearance of natural quarried stone (e.g., marble or granite) in a consistent and repeatable manner, a limitation of prior engineered stone products (’762 Patent, col. 1:21-37).
  • The Patented Solution: The invention is a synthetic molded slab and a system for its creation. The process involves sequentially dispensing two or more differently pigmented particulate mineral mixes (primarily quartz and a resin binder) into a single slab mold (’762 Patent, col. 2:63-66). This is achieved using a series of complementary stencils, where a first stencil directs the placement of a first mix, and a second "negative" stencil directs a second mix into the remaining empty regions (’762 Patent, col. 2:27-50; '762 Patent, FIG. 7). The combined mixes are then compacted and cured to form a single slab with distinct, full-thickness veining patterns (’762 Patent, abstract).
  • Technical Importance: This stencil-based method allows for the mass production of engineered slabs with complex, pre-defined veining patterns that are highly similar from one slab to the next, overcoming the randomness of natural stone and the simplicity of prior engineered products (’762 Patent, col. 4:11-25).

Key Claims at a Glance

  • The complaint asserts claims 22-25 (Compl. ¶30). Independent claim 22 is representative.
  • Essential Elements of Claim 22:
    • A processed slab with a rectangular shape of at least 2 feet by 6 feet.
    • A major surface comprising a first particulate mineral mix and a second particulate mineral mix.
    • The first mix occupies the entire slab thickness at a set of first regions, which include a "first vein in a generally width-wise direction" and a "second vein in a generally lengthwise direction."
    • The second mix occupies the entire slab thickness at a set of second regions.
    • The first and second mixes are different, each comprising quartz and one or more binders.
    • The first mix is absent from the second regions, and the second mix is absent from the first regions.
  • The complaint does not explicitly reserve the right to assert dependent claims for this patent.

U.S. Patent No. 10,252,440 - Processed Slabs, and Systems and Methods Related Thereto (Issued Apr. 9, 2019)

The Invention Explained

  • Problem Addressed: As with the related ’762 Patent, the ’440 patent addresses the challenge of creating reproducible, aesthetically complex veining in engineered stone slabs (’440 Patent, col. 1:25-38).
  • The Patented Solution: The patent claims a process for forming a synthetic molded slab. The method involves using a first stencil to dispense a first pigmented quartz mix into a first set of regions in a slab mold, followed by using a second stencil to dispense a second pigmented quartz mix into a different, second set of regions (’440 Patent, col. 2:25-50). The deposited mixes are then vibrated and compacted to form a processed slab with a major surface of at least 3 feet by 6 feet (’440 Patent, abstract; '440 Patent, col. 2:50-57).
  • Technical Importance: By claiming the specific manufacturing method, the patent protects the stencil-based technique for creating repeatable, complex designs, which is a key process for achieving the desired product appearance (’440 Patent, col. 4:11-24).

Key Claims at a Glance

  • The complaint asserts claims 14-20 (Compl. ¶38). Independent claim 14 is representative.
  • Essential Elements of Claim 14:
    • A process of forming a processed slab.
    • Sequentially dispensing at least a first and a second pigmented particulate mineral mix into a slab mold having a first and second set of regions.
    • The first mix is different from the second mix.
    • The first mix is dispensed into the first set of regions, and the second mix is dispensed into the second set of regions.
    • Vibrating and compacting the mixes to form a slab that is rectangular with a major surface of at least 3 feet by 6 feet.
  • The complaint does not explicitly reserve the right to assert dependent claims for this patent.

U.S. Patent No. 12,370,718 - Processed Slabs, and Systems and Methods Related Thereto (Issued July 29, 2025)

Technology Synopsis

The ’718 Patent, a member of the same family as the ’762 and ’440 patents, is directed at the final processed slab product. It claims a slab with a "background" defined by a first particulate mineral mix and a "plurality of veins" defined by a second, different mix, where the second pattern is a negative of the first (’718 Patent, col. 13:30-44). The patent focuses on the structural and visual relationship between the background and veining materials that make up the slab.

Asserted Claims

Claims 1, 2, and 4-16 are asserted (Compl. ¶46).

Accused Features

The complaint alleges that the Accused Products, including the Silestone brand slabs, embody the claimed slab structure having a distinct background and a plurality of veins (Compl. ¶25; Compl. ¶46).

III. The Accused Instrumentality

Product Identification

The Accused Products are processed quartz slabs sold by Cosentino, at least under the Silestone brand name (Compl. ¶25). Specific non-limiting examples cited include "Calacatta Themis," "Calacatta Tova," "Bronze Rivers," "Blanc Elysee," "Chateau Brown," and "Eclectic Pearl" (Compl. ¶25; Compl. ¶26).

Functionality and Market Context

  • The Accused Products are engineered stone slabs used for applications such as countertops, floor tiles, and vanities (Compl. ¶14). Functionally, they are designed to provide a durable, nonabsorbent, and scratch-resistant surface (Compl. ¶16). The complaint provides an image showing several of the Accused Products, which feature prominent, high-contrast veining patterns designed to emulate natural stone (Compl. ¶26).
  • The complaint alleges that Cosentino markets, imports, distributes, and sells these products throughout the United States, including within the Western District of Texas (Compl. ¶8; Compl. ¶11).

IV. Analysis of Infringement Allegations

The complaint alleges that claim charts detailing the infringement are attached as Exhibits D, E, and F; however, these exhibits were not provided with the complaint document (Compl. ¶30; Compl. ¶38; Compl. ¶46). The narrative infringement theory is summarized below.

  • ’762 Patent and ’718 Patent (Product Claims): The complaint alleges that Cosentino’s Accused Products directly infringe the product claims of the ’762 and ’718 patents (Compl. ¶30; Compl. ¶46). The core of this allegation is that the physical construction of products like "Calacatta Themis" meets the limitations of the asserted claims. This includes having the specified dimensions, being composed of different particulate mineral mixes (e.g., a background mix and a vein mix), and having those mixes arranged to form the claimed vein structures, such as the "width-wise" and "lengthwise" veins of the ’762 Patent or the "background" and "plurality of veins" of the ’718 Patent (Compl. ¶25; Compl. ¶30; Compl. ¶46). An image provided in the complaint shows exemplary accused products with distinct, multi-directional veining patterns (Compl. ¶26).
  • ’440 Patent (Method Claims): The complaint alleges that the Accused Products are made using a process that infringes the method claims of the ’440 Patent (Compl. ¶24; Compl. ¶38). Under 35 U.S.C. § 271(g), importation, sale, or use of a product made by a patented process can constitute infringement. The allegation is that Cosentino’s manufacturing process involves the claimed steps of sequentially dispensing different quartz mixes into a mold according to a pattern, followed by compaction, to create the final slabs (Compl. ¶38).
  • Identified Points of Contention:
    • Technical Questions: A primary factual question will be whether the physical composition and structure of the Accused Products map onto the specific vein configurations and material distributions required by the product claims in the ’762 and ’718 patents. For the ’440 patent, a key question will be evidentiary: what proof can Cambria adduce that the process used by Cosentino to manufacture the slabs, prior to importation, includes the specific steps recited in the method claims?
    • Scope Questions: The analysis may turn on how the court construes terms defining the slab's appearance. For instance, does the visual pattern on a product like "Calacatta Themis" satisfy the claim requirement for both a "width-wise" and a "lengthwise" vein as defined in the ’762 Patent?

V. Key Claim Terms for Construction

For the ’762 Patent (Claim 22)

  • The Term: "a first vein in a generally width-wise direction... and a second vein in a generally lengthwise direction"
  • Context and Importance: This limitation defines the fundamental visual structure of the claimed slab. The dispute may center on whether the patterns in the Accused Products contain distinct elements that can be fairly characterized as running in these two different general directions, or if the patterns are more random or omnidirectional.
  • Intrinsic Evidence for Interpretation:
    • Evidence for a Broader Interpretation: The term "generally" suggests the directions do not need to be perfectly linear or strictly perpendicular. The specification describes creating patterns that "emulate a quarried stone slab," which often have complex and irregular veining (’762 Patent, col. 2:55-58). This may support a construction that accommodates non-linear or meandering veins as long as their overall orientation is width-wise or lengthwise.
    • Evidence for a Narrower Interpretation: The claim separately recites both a "width-wise" and "lengthwise" vein, suggesting two distinct and identifiable features must be present. The patent figures, such as FIG. 1 and FIG. 6, depict clear, separate regions of different materials that could be interpreted as forming distinct veins (’762 Patent, FIG. 1; '762 Patent, FIG. 6). A defendant might argue that these embodiments limit the terms to more defined, distinguishable linear features.

For the ’440 Patent (Claim 14)

  • The Term: "sequentially dispensing"
  • Context and Importance: This term is central to the claimed manufacturing process. The infringement analysis for this method patent will depend on whether Cosentino's process involves a time-ordered deposition of different materials, as required by the claim.
  • Intrinsic Evidence for Interpretation:
    • Evidence for a Broader Interpretation: The term "sequentially" may simply require that the first dispensation step is completed before the second begins, without precluding other intermediate steps or variations in timing. The overall goal is to place different materials in different regions, and any process achieving this in a step-wise fashion could be argued to fall within the term's scope.
    • Evidence for a Narrower Interpretation: The specification describes a specific sequence of using a first stencil, dispensing a first mix, removing the first stencil, positioning a second stencil, and dispensing a second mix (’440 Patent, col. 12:20-49; '440 Patent, FIG. 7). This detailed embodiment could be used to argue for a narrower construction that requires a distinct and separate two-step stencil-based process, rather than any process that happens to be time-ordered.

VI. Other Allegations

  • Indirect Infringement: The complaint alleges induced infringement for all three patents. The factual basis alleged is that Cosentino actively encourages infringement by third parties (e.g., distributors, fabricators, and end-users) through its marketing materials, website content, and sales and distribution channels (Compl. ¶31; Compl. ¶32; Compl. ¶39; Compl. ¶40; Compl. ¶47; Compl. ¶48).
  • Willful Infringement: Willfulness is alleged for all three patents. For the ’762 and ’440 patents, the complaint bases this on Cosentino’s alleged knowledge of the patents since at least September 30, 2020, arising from prior litigation between the parties (Compl. ¶28; Compl. ¶36; Compl. ¶44). For the ’718 patent, the basis is alleged knowledge since at least February 11, 2026, from a letter providing notice of the patent (Compl. ¶28; Compl. ¶52). The complaint alleges that Cosentino continued its infringing activities despite this knowledge.

VII. Analyst’s Conclusion: Key Questions for the Case

  • Evidentiary Proof of Process: A central issue for the ’440 method patent will be one of evidentiary access and proof. Can Cambria demonstrate that the specific process Cosentino uses in its overseas facilities to manufacture the imported slabs practices the "sequentially dispensing" steps required by the claims? This often presents a significant discovery challenge in product-by-process cases.
  • Technical Infringement and Claim Scope: A key question will be one of pattern interpretation. Do the aesthetic designs of the Accused Products, which are meant to appear complex and natural, meet the specific structural limitations of the asserted product claims, such as the requirement for distinct "width-wise" and "lengthwise" veins? The case may depend on whether the court adopts a broad or narrow construction of these descriptive terms.
  • Impact of Prior Litigation: The allegation of willfulness appears particularly significant given the parties' litigation history. A core question for the court will be whether Cosentino's design and sale of the new Accused Products, after settling a prior case on the same patents, constitutes objectively reckless behavior sufficient to support a finding of willful infringement and potential enhanced damages.
